Digital Magics goes public on Milan's Stock Exchange

Digital Magics, (Ticker: DM) the venture incubator of digital startups went public today at 9am when it’s shares started to be traded at Borsa Italiana (Italian Stock Exchange) on AIM Italia, the Alternative Investment Market for small and medium-sized Italian enterprises with high growth potential.

The company was supported in the listing process by the following partners: Integrae SIM, as Global Coordinator and Nomad adviser, DLA Piper who ensured its support for legal issues, BDO, as audit company in charge of accounting issues, Burson-Marsteller who dealt with the financial communication, Cattaneo Zanetto & Co. who managed institutional relationships and LEXIS who provided fiscal advice.

Integrae SIM will act as specialist in accordance with the AIM ITALIA Issuer Regulations (Regolamento Emittenti AIM Italia).

The placing operation concerned the issue of 1,239,247 new shares of which 630,847 for the purpose of the conversion in advance of the convertible bonds issued by the company and 608,400 in connection with the capital increase reserved for qualified investors.

The total capital increase amounts to 8,585,000 euro (including the share-premium); therefore, the post-listing capitalization of the company results in about 25.6 million euro with floating funds equal to about 37% of the total capital.

The trading initial price was set at 7.50 euro per share.

“We believe that AIM Italia can play a crucial role in the set-up of an Italian venture capital market, by supporting the development of technology companies with high growth potential and cooperating with all operators, such as funds and investment companies that are already operating within the innovation marketplace” – says Enrico Gasperini, Founder and Chairman of Digital Magics in a note released by the freshly listed company – “In other countries, secondary markets play a key role helping innovative small- and medium-sized enterprises to carry out their growth. The most successful enterprises will be able to fully access the primary market. As a matter of fact, our initiative is an ecosystem-based operation aiming to strengthen our leadership position in this key marketplace”.

For the transmission of information, Digital Magics chose to use the SDIR-NIS circuit, run by BIt Market Services, a subsidiary of London Stock Exchange Group. The admission document is available in the Investor Relations section of the website www.digitalmagics.com.
